Geometry in preschool? Yes! Children ages 3–5 are beginning to learn about shapes, spaces, and locations—basic concepts of geometry. 🔶 Read more about geometric thinking in this tip sheet. #TipSheetTuesday #IllinoisEarlyLearning illinoisearlylearning.org/ti…
